Кто такой Администратор баз данных: кто это такой, обязанности, зарплаты и как им стать в 2025 году
Администратор баз данных (DBA) — это специалист, который отвечает за здоровье, устойчивость и производительность хранилищ данных компании. От четкости его работы зависит скорость бизнес-процессов, корректность отчетности и безопасность критических сведений. В коммерческих проектах любой сбой в БД тут же превращается в простой сервисов и прямые потери, поэтому к роли предъявляют высокие требования. В IT-командах DBA часто выступает связующим звеном между разработкой, аналитикой и инфраструктурой, удерживая систему в рабочем состоянии при постоянных изменениях.
Профессия подходит тем, кто любит порядок, разбирается в деталях и спокойно относится к регламентам. Здесь ценится системное мышление, аккуратность и готовность отвечать за результат. При этом работа не сводится к рутине: задачи варьируются от настройки отказоустойчивых кластеров до тонкой работы с планами выполнения запросов. Рынок ощущает острую потребность в специалистах, которые умеют и проектировать, и сопровождать БД — именно они помогают продуктам расти без потери качества.
Описание профессии: кто такой и чем он занимается
DBA обеспечивает доступность, целостность и скорость работы СУБД: PostgreSQL, MySQL, Oracle, MS SQL Server и других. В его зоне ответственности — установка, настройка, резервное копирование, восстановление, мониторинг и масштабирование. Он анализирует запросы, настраивает индексы, управляет правами доступа и следит за безопасностью. В критические моменты именно DBA принимает решения, как вернуть сервис к жизни и не потерять данные.
Помимо операционных задач, администратор участвует в проектировании схемы данных вместе с разработчиками и аналитиками. Он предлагает разумные типы данных, продумывает ключи и ограничения, готовит миграции и тестирует их на стендах. Еще одна важная часть — документация и автоматизация: скрипты, политики резервного копирования, чек-листы на случай аварий. В зрелых командах DBA формирует единые стандарты, чтобы все сервисы говорили на одном «языке» данных.
Этапы развития карьеры
Начальный этап — Junior DBA: работа по инструкциям, настройка мониторинга, регулярные бэкапы, простые миграции. Следующий уровень — Middle: фокус на производительности, разбор планов, репликация, аварийные тренировки, участие в проектировании. Далее — Senior: архитектура, масштабирование, безопасность, выстраивание регламентов и наставничество. При желании путь ведет в роли SRE, платформенного инженера или архитектора данных.
Параллельно развивается лидерская ветка: тимлид DBA, руководитель платформы данных, глава направления в крупной организации. Здесь к технической базе добавляются бюджетирование, приоритизация задач и найм. Зрелые специалисты формируют стандарты, проводят аудиты и менторят команды разработки. Такой трек дает широкий кругозор и влияние на стратегию продукта.
Зарплаты
Уровень дохода зависит от региона, стека технологий, масштаба инфраструктуры и зон ответственности. В компаниях с высокой нагрузкой и строгими SLA оплата выше, потому что цена ошибки крупнее, а требований к доступности больше. Добавляет очков опыт в отказоустойчивых кластерах, репликации, настройке шифрования и аудита. На вилку влияет и график: дежурства по инцидентам и ночные окна для работ обычно компенсируются доплатой.
Ориентиры по грейдам часто выглядят так:
| Грейд | Роль и зона ответственности | Диапазон, ₽ в мес. |
|---|---|---|
| Junior DBA | Рутина под присмотром, бэкапы, простые миграции, базовый мониторинг | 80 000–150 000 |
| Middle DBA | Производительность, репликация, аварийное восстановление, участие в проектировании | 160 000–260 000 |
| Senior DBA | Архитектура, масштабирование, безопасность, наставничество, ответственность за SLA | 270 000–420 000+ |
Цифры варьируются по рынку и быстро меняются, поэтому перед переговорами стоит сверяться с актуальными вакансиями и учитывать специфику домена. Чем ближе профиль к высокой нагрузке и финансовым рискам, тем выше спрос на зрелых специалистов.
Обязанности и необходимые навыки
Базовый набор — уверенное владение SQL и понимание работы планировщика запросов. К этому добавляются знания внутреннего устройства выбранной СУБД: механизм транзакций, блокировок, индексов, буферного кэша. Для продакшена необходим опыт настройки репликации, шардирования, резервного копирования и восстановления до точки во времени. Полезны навыки Linux и администрирования сетей, ведь БД живет в окружении сервисов, балансировщиков и хранилищ.
Из личных качеств важны терпение, внимательность к мелочам и дисциплина. Ошибки в конфигурации проявляются не сразу, а через нагрузку или отказ оборудования, и тут помогает привычка проверять гипотезы и вести логи изменений. Коммуникация тоже критична: DBA объясняет разработчикам, почему запрос тормозит, а менеджерам — как устроены риски. Спокойный тон, ясные формулировки и умение отделять факты от предположений повышают доверие к решениям специалиста.
Профессиональные требования
Работодатели ждут крепкий SQL, умение читать планы запросов и уверенную работу с индексами. На уровне инфраструктуры нужны навыки настройки репликации, понимание CAP-компромиссов, знание вариантности изоляции транзакций. Обязательны бэкапы, проверка восстановления и документированная процедура аварий. В вопросах безопасности ценится шифрование на диске и в канале, разграничение ролей и аудит доступа.
К софт-скиллам относят ответственность, ясную письменную коммуникацию и умение объяснять сложные идеи простыми словами. Важна привычка к измерениям: графики, алерты, метрики, отчеты по инцидентам. Ожидается дисциплина в релизах и миграциях, умение планировать окна работ и согласовывать их с командами. Приветствуется готовность к менторству и обучению коллег.
Должностные обязанности интервьюера
Когда DBA выступает интервьюером, его задача — проверить практические навыки кандидата и способность мысленно моделировать систему. Он предлагает задачи на чтение плана запроса, оценку индексов, поиск блокировок и план аварийного восстановления. Важна проверка понимания компромиссов: скорость против консистентности, простота схемы против гибкости, частота бэкапов против времени восстановления. Интервьюер смотрит не только на ответ, но и на ход мыслей, логику проверки гипотез и аккуратность формулировок.
Хорошая практика — короткий живой разбор инцидента: «упал узел репликации», «рассыпался индекс», «под нагрузкой выросла латентность». Кандидату предлагают действия по шагам, ожидая четкий план и оценку рисков. Дополняет картину культурное соответствие: отношение к документации, готовность признавать ошибки, умение задавать уточняющие вопросы. По итогам интервью формируется структурированная обратная связь с примерами наблюдений.
Плюсы
- Высокая значимость для бизнеса и заметное влияние на стабильность сервисов.
- Разнообразие задач: от архитектурных решений до тонкой настройки производительности.
- Сильный спрос на рынке и достойная оплата при росте экспертизы.
- Понятная траектория развития: от операционного уровня к системному и архитектурному.
К плюсам многие относят ясные критерии качества: время отклика, доступность, успешно пройденные проверки восстановления. Результат видно в метриках и в снижении числа инцидентов, что повышает профессиональную уверенность. Еще одно достоинство — накопительный эффект знаний: каждая решенная авария добавляет к репертуару проверенные приемы. На фоне ускоряющихся релизов такая предсказуемость ценится особенно.
Минусы
- Дежурства и ночные окна для миграций, высокий уровень ответственности.
- Стресс в пиковые нагрузки и во время инцидентов, где нужно сохранять холодную голову.
- Много рутины вокруг обновлений, патчей и согласований изменений.
- Нужно непрерывно учиться новым версиям СУБД и сопутствующим инструментам.
К сложностям добавляется баланс интересов: бизнес требует скорости, разработчики — гибкости, безопасность — строгих регламентов. DBA держит эти векторы в рамках одной стратегии, что требует выдержки и ясной коммуникации. Еще одна зона риска — одиночные роли без подмены, где отпуск превращается в редкость. Выправляет ситуацию четкая распределенная ответственность и автоматизация рутинных операций.
Как освоить профессию с нуля
Стартовая траектория понятна: основы баз данных, уверенный SQL, практика с одной популярной СУБД и инструменты мониторинга. Хороший ход — развернуть локальный стенд, нагенерировать данные, попытаться ускорить медленные запросы и зафиксировать результаты. Важная привычка — читать официальную документацию и повторять примеры руками, а не ограничиваться конспектами. С первых шагов стоит учиться работать с бэкапами и проверять восстановление — это формирует правильное отношение к надежности.
Далее пригодятся скриптовые языки (Bash, Python), базовые навыки контейнеризации и понимание облачных сервисов. Полезны курсы по СУБД и нагрузочному тестированию, а также участие в пет-проектах, где можно столкнуться с реальными проблемами: конкуренция за ресурсы, рост объема данных, ночные миграции. Сильный плюс — участие в техподдержке или стажировке, где появляются тревоги, аварии и ответственность за SLA. Такой опыт быстро оттачивает реакцию и формирует практический взгляд на архитектуру.
Где обучиться
Старт возможен в вузах с программами по информационным технологиям, но реальную скорость дает практика. Учебные центры и онлайн-курсы предлагают треки по конкретным СУБД, где много лабораторных работ и задач, приближенных к боевым. Полезны тренажеры по аварийному восстановлению и нагрузочному тестированию — они воспитывают уверенность и дисциплину. Важная часть обучения — сообщества: чаты, митапы, конференции, где обсуждают ошибки и находки.
Хорошую прибавку к теории дают собственные проекты: от домашнего медиа-сервера до pet-магазина с заказами и отчетами. Такие задачи заставляют продумывать схему, настраивать резервирование, проверять отказоустойчивость и наблюдаемость. Наличие публичного репозитория с инфраструктурным кодом повышает доверие работодателя: видно подход к качеству и отношение к деталям. Для перехода в продакшен помогает стажировка или роль младшего специалиста в поддержке.
Гдe работать по профессии?
DBA востребован в e-commerce, финтехе, логистике, телеком-сегменте, здравоохранении и госсекторе. В продуктовых IT-командах администратор ведет несколько баз, следит за копиями и производительностью сервисов. В интеграторах и консалтинге специалист подключается к проектам, где нужно быстро стабилизировать нагрузку и навести порядок в схемах. В крупных компаниях часто есть платформа данных, где DBA взаимодействует с DevOps, SRE и аналитиками.
Формат занятости гибкий: офис, гибрид, полностью удаленная работа. Осторожно стоит относиться к одиночным позициям без резервирования роли: нагрузка растет, а риски выгорания тоже. В командах, где выстроена сменность и дежурства, комфорт выше, потому что ответственность и ночные работы распределены равномерно. При выборе места разумно оценивать зрелость процессов и прозрачность приоритетов.
ТОП курсов баз данных по SQL: подборка для начинающих и продвинутых специалистов
Если вы хотите освоить SQL с нуля или прокачать навыки работы с базами данных, эта подборка поможет выбрать подходящий курс. Варианты есть для аналитиков, разработчиков и специалистов по обработке данных.
- SQL с нуля от Sky.pro — интенсивный курс с индивидуальным форматом обучения.
- SQL с нуля для анализа данных от Eduson Academy — подходит для тех, кто хочет изучить SQL с нуля и применять его в аналитике.
- Курс по SQL для анализа данных от Skillfactory — гибкая программа, позволяющая учиться в удобном режиме.
- SQL для разработки от Яндекс Практикум — идеальный вариант для разработчиков, которым нужен SQL в работе.
- Обработка и анализ данных в SQL от SF Education — доступный курс, ориентированный на практическое применение.
- SQL для работы с данными и аналитики от Яндекс Практикум — обучение с бонусами и дополнительными материалами.
- SQL и получение данных от Нетологии — курс с акцентом на практическую работу с реальными базами данных.
- SQL для анализа данных от Skillbox — программа специально для аналитиков, желающих работать с большими объемами информации.
- Продвинутый SQL от Нетологии — интенсивный курс для тех, кто хочет быстро освоить продвинутые техники.
- SQL с нуля для анализа данных от ProductStar — интенсивная программа для быстрого старта в аналитике.
- SQL: получение и анализ данных от Бруноям — экспресс-курс для специалистов по анализу данных, ориентированный на работу с реальными задачами.
Выбирайте программу, соответствующую вашим целям, и осваивайте SQL для уверенной работы с данными.
Коротко о главном
Администратор баз данных обеспечивает стабильность, скорость и безопасность ядра цифровых сервисов. Для успеха нужны крепкий SQL, понимание внутренностей СУБД, навыки резервирования и восстановления, автоматизация и дисциплина. Карьера строится на практике: стенды, инциденты, измерения, документация и обмен опытом в командах. Профессия подходит тем, кто ценит порядок, точность и готов брать ответственность за данные, на которых держится бизнес.
Реклама. Информация о рекламодателе по ссылкам в статье.
О других профессиях:
- Администратор баз данных
- Методист Онлайн Курсов
- Go Разработчик
- Астролог
- Вокалист
- Рунолог
- Devops Инженер
- Гештальт психолог
- PHP Разработчик
- Таргетолог
- Javascript Разработчик
- SQL Разработчик
- 3D Аниматор
- Менеджер
- 2D Художник
- Моушн Дизайнер
- Тайм Менеджер
- Фотограф
- Иллюстратор
- 3D Дженералист
- 3D Дизайнер
- Аналитик Big Data
- Маркетолог Аналитик
- Профессия 3D Художник
- Стилист Имиджмейкер
- Администратор Instagram
- Data Engineer
- Bi Аналитик
- Product Owner
- Seo Специалист
- HR-аналитик
- Affiliate-менеджер
- Специалист по госзакупкам
- NLP-специалист (инженер)
- Рилсмейкер
- Парикмахер
- Аналитик продаж
- Кинорежиссер
- Дизайнер Интерьера
- Регрессолог
- Лешмейкер
- Дирижер
- Зеро-кодер (No code)
- Сторисмейкер
- Блоггер
- Арт Менеджер
- Педагог
- Оратор
- Кадровик
- Конструктор Одежды
